Step 2: Add Your Contact Information
Enter your full name, mailing address, phone number, and email at the top of the letter. Check each detail carefully. Errors in contact information can prevent an employer from reaching you.
Step 3: Address the Employer
Fill in the name of the hiring manager and the company name in the address block. If you do not have a specific contact, use "Dear Hiring Manager" as your salutation. Addressing a real person always makes a stronger impression.
Step 4: Describe Your Qualifications
Write two or three sentences about your most relevant skills and accomplishments. Be specific about results. Mention the job title and one key qualification in the first paragraph. This shows the employer you read the job posting carefully.
Step 5: Close With a Request
Ask for an interview in your closing paragraph. State when you are available and thank the employer for their time. Sign off with "Sincerely" or "Best regards" followed by your full name. Download or print the completed letter from the editor.
Tips for a Stronger Cover Letter
Keep your fill in the blank cover letter to one page. Hiring managers review applications quickly, and a focused letter is easier to read. Customize each version for the specific role and do not send the same generic letter to every employer. Review for spelling errors before submitting.
